Spring Craft Sale 2017

 

Folk really are fabulous and have been asking about our Spring Craft sale. We are delighted to confirm it will be going ahead, any funds raised will be going to support our Ongoing projects.
We are going to run our online Spring Craft sale in a similar way to previous sales.

We’d love your help…

We are looking to make and sell small/lightweight Eastery/Spring/ Generally gorgeous items. Sewn, crocheted, knitted, any crafty crafts, the how is up to you! To keep postage costs to a minimum we ask that ideally anything made can be sent on to a buyer in a ‘Large’ envelope. Bigger items are welcome too, we are just aware of postal charges!

Some suggestions for you but we are open to others!
* Easter decorations – chicks, eggs, sheeeeps, rabbits.
* Easter/spring bunting/ garlands, decorations
* Brooches, keyrings, purses, accessories
* Other Lovely Things???!!!

Last posting for crafts to be Saturday 18th March

Please message for posting information. Thank you so much.
The Sale itself will take place between Thursday 23rd – Saturday 25th March. Times tbc.

It will be run through an Event page on Facebook (Woolly Hugs) , with a selection of items on our Auction site here on the website to help those not on FB
